<p>Victims of the McKinney Fire that destroyed homes and killed four people in Siskiyou County have sued the Oregon-based utility company providing power in far Northern California, claiming PacifiCorp powerlines sparked the fire.</p>
<p>While fire investigators with the United States Forest Service remain tight-lipped about what caused the blaze, the lawsuit argues power equipment is to blame.  The fire ignited July 29 at a time of dangerous fire weather in a rural area by McKinney Creek near Klamath River, an unincorporated community on Highway 96 in Siskiyou County.</p>
<p>Tom Gauntt, a spokesperson for PacifiCorp, declined to answer questions about the McKinney Fire and said the lawsuit prevented the company from discussing the matter.</p>
<p>PacifiCorp, which operates as Pacific Power in California, filed a report with the California Public Utilities Commission six days after the fire started, alerting regulators that its equipment was in the area of ​​a fire.  The company did not report any problems with its equipment to state regulators.  Drew Hanson, another spokesman for PacifiCorp, told the Chronicle on Aug. 3 that “we are not aware of any equipment being collected for an investigation related to the McKinney Fire.”</p>
<p>Attorney Gerald Singleton said his firm&#8217;s investigator reported that overhead power lines were the only human infrastructure in the remote forested area where the fire started — no roads, structures or campsites.  His San Diego-based firm, Singleton Schreiber, is representing about 25 property owners with losses from the fire.</p>
<p>&#8220;There&#8217;s nothing anyone has seen that would lead us to believe that the McKinney Fire started with anything other than power lines,&#8221; Singleton said.</p>
<p>A 911 caller reported the first flames of the McKinney Fire just before 2:15 pm on July 29. Emergency dispatch audio from some of the first fire units on scene describe the early flames.  “About a quarter acre ….  right now putting water on it &#8230; it is underneath the power line right-of-way,” a firefighter reported over the radio at about 2:30 pm</p>
<p>Singleton said his firm&#8217;s investigator was informed that the Forest Service collected power equipment from the origin site as evidence.  He said they will request access to inspect the equipment in the course of civil litigation proceedings.</p>
<p>Adrienne Freeman, a spokesperson for the Forest Service, said the agency&#8217;s investigators were still determining how the fire started and were working with assistance from the Siskiyou County Sheriff&#8217;s Office.  Freeman declined to say whether any power equipment had been collected as potential evidence.</p>
<p>The lawsuit alleges PacifiCorp was negligent in its maintenance, operation and inspection of its power lines and names another 2020 wildfire in California that spurred a lawsuit blaming PacifiCorp for the destruction: the Slater Fire that burned 157,229 acres and killed two people in the Klamath National Forest .  The cause of that fire is still under investigation.  PacifiCorp did not immediately respond to a request for comment on the Slater Fire.</p>
<p>The McKinney Fire has burned 60,392 acres and is 95% contained.  The blaze destroyed at least 196 structures.  Those killed include longtime US Forest Service fire lookout Kathy Shoopman.

<p>SAN FRANCISCO — San Francisco supervisors voted Tuesday to put the brakes on a controversial policy that would let police use robots for deadly force.</p>
<p>The Board of Supervisors unanimously voted to explicitly ban the use of robots in such fashion for now.  But they sent the issue back to a committee for further discussion and could allow it in limited cases at another time.</p>
<p>It&#8217;s a reversal from last week&#8217;s vote allowing the use of robots in limited cases.  The police said they had no plans to arm the robots with guns but wanted the ability to put explosives on them in extraordinary circumstances.</p>
<p>Last week&#8217;s approval generated pushback and criticism about the potential to deploy robots that can kill people.</p>
<p>Some supervisors said they felt the public did not have enough time to engage in the discussion about whether robots could be used to kill people before the board first voted last week.</p>
<p>The vote was the result of a new state law that requires police departments to inventory military-grade equipment and seek approval for its use.</p>
<p>The approved policy does give the police power to use robots for situational awareness, such as going first into a dangerous situation so police can stay back.</p>

<p>SAN FRANCISCO (AP) — Two San Francisco gang members who opened fire during a funeral reception for a pimp, killing one person and wounding four innocent bystanders, were sentenced Wednesday to life in federal prison, prosecutors said.</p>
<p>Robert Manning, 31, and Jamare Coats, 29, were sentenced for a March 23, 2019 shooting that took place in front of the Fillmore Heritage Center and not far from a police station.</p>
<p>The men who belonged to a local street gang got into a shootout on a crowded sidewalk during which at least 24 shots were fired, the US attorney&#8217;s office for the Northern District of California said in a statement.</p>
<p>Prosecutors said the battle began with a confrontation between several gang members and associates attending a reception at the center for Ron Newt, who had died that month at 69. Newt was a well-known and flamboyant San Francisco pimp in the 1970s and 1980s.</p>
<p>The victim, 25-year-old Mister Dee Carnell Simmons III, &#8220;acted disrespectfully towards them, branding a firearm and threatening&#8221; them, the US attorney&#8217;s statement said.</p>
<p>Manning, Coats and others left the building and went to their parked cars where Manning and Coats armed themselves and got into the shootout with Simmons, who died of his wounds, authorities said.</p>
<p>Four other people were wounded in the crossfire, including a bystander who was shot in the back and paralyzed from the waist down as he tried to escape the shooting, prosecutors said.</p>
<p>Manning and Coats were convicted in August of murder in aid of racketeering and of being felons in possession of firearms.</p>

<p>OAKLAND (KPIX) — A deadly fire at a homeless encampment in West Oakland Tuesday was the last straw for Caltrans, with agency officials saying the camp under Interstate 880 needs to go.</p>
<p>One person was killed and three RVs and two cars were destroyed Tuesday afternoon in the fatal fire that sent a massive plume of black smoke overhead.  Five people who lived in the camp were displaced.</p>
<p lang="en" dir="ltr">A man died in his RV as a fire ripped through his vehicle that was parked at the Wood St. encampment in #Oakland this afternoon.  According to OFD, the fire spread from one RV to the one where the deceased person was discovered.  In total, five vehicles were destroyed.  @KPIXtv pic.twitter.com/fQ3QTjqs6I</p>
<p>— BrianKPIX (@brianyuenKPIX) April 5, 2022</p>

<p>KPIX 5 has learned that Caltrans has decided that the massive encampment beneath Interstate 880 must be cleared, and soon.</p>
<p>The agency said the deadly RV fire Tuesday was one of more than 100 fires in recent years.  Planning is now underway for a large-scale intervention.</p>
<p>The Wood Street encampment starts just north of the old 16th Street Train Station and stretches almost to the 580 interchange.  That&#8217;s about three quarters of a mile.</p>
<p>For the hundreds of people living in the camp, the fatal fire might be what leads to their next move.</p>
<p>&#8220;You know, I knew a life would be lost sooner or later,&#8221; said camp resident Dearlean Bailey.  &#8220;I told people that was coming.&#8221;</p>
<p>Bailey lives about 100 yards from the scene of Tuesday&#8217;s fire.  It did not come as a surprise to her, nor is she surprised to hear that Caltrans is now talking about taking action.</p>
<p>&#8220;There are several different entities down there,&#8221; said Caltrans Deputy District Director for External Affairs Cheryl Chambers.  “East Bay MUD, Union Pacific, Burlington Northern, City of Oakland, ourselves.  So we all<br />need to get together and talk about what needs to happen in a short timeframe.”</p>
<p>Caltrans told KPIX all of those parties will meet before the week is over to begin discussing some kind of resolution for the encampment.  The agency said it will involve moving everyone out.</p>

<p>SANTA ROSA (AP) &#8211; The country&#8217;s largest utility company has long vowed to change its ruthless ways.  After leaving a trail of death and destruction through Northern California in less than three years, the fifth CEO of Pacific Gas &#038; Electric has renewed promises that the future will be &#8220;easier&#8221; and &#8220;brighter&#8221;.</p>
<p>But the promises CEO Patricia “Patti” Poppe made in her first letter to shareholders sound a year after PG&#038;E emerged from one of the most complex bankruptcies in US history, an act of desperation followed by a series of devastating forest fires that was triggered by its long-neglected power grid.</p>
<p>The bankruptcy, PG &#038; E&#8217;s second in less than 20 years, was billed as an opportunity for a utility company that powers 16 million people &#8211; a population larger than all but a handful of states &#8211; to finally reset Button to press.</p>
<p>So far, however, it has looked more like a reminder of problems that have led to tragedy after tragedy over the past six years, including a 2018 wildfire that killed 85 people and the town of Paradise, about 274 kilometers northeast of, San Francisco was destroyed.</p>
<p>PG&#038;E is already a twice convicted felon and has been charged with another round of arson crimes which it denies commission.  The utility was also reprimanded by California regulators and a federal judge overseeing his parole for breaking promises to reduce the dangers of trees near his power lines.</p>
<p>And most of the 70,000 or so victims who have made claims of devastation from PG &#038; E&#8217;s past misdeeds are still awaiting payment from a $ 13.5 billion trust created during bankruptcy.  The Trust faces a deficit of nearly $ 2 billion because half of its funding comes from company stocks, though critics say it&#8217;s foolhardy to hold an interest in a utility company with such a poor record.</p>
<p>These stocks have slumped in a rising stock market.  A stroke of luck could still come if PG &#038; E&#8217;s shares rebound, as several analysts have forecast, but confidence would find itself in an even deeper hole if the stock fell any further.</p>
<p>There are legitimate concerns that if the utility stirs another deadly wildfire in the next four months, stocks will collapse as most of PG &#038; E’s sprawling service area has sunk into extreme drought and climate change, worsening fire conditions in western America USA contributes.</p>
<p>“Of course I&#8217;m nervous.  My biggest fear is what will happen to the stock, ”said John Trotter, head of the Forest Fire Victims Trust, which owns almost one in four PG&#038;E shares &#8211; far more than any other investor.</p>
<p>Trotter, a retired federal judge who serves as a trustee on $ 1,500 an hour, has other headaches as well.  He and over 300 workers have come under heavy criticism for slow payments to victims who lost their families, homes and other property nearly three to six years ago.</p>
<p>In the first six months of its operation last year, the Trust paid out just $ 7.2 million to victims while incurring nearly $ 39 million in operating expenses, which, according to its financial records, reduced the amount available for disbursement .</p>
<p>&#8220;I look at it like a locomotive that starts slowly, but we&#8217;re blowing the steam off now and we&#8217;re starting to roll now,&#8221; Trotter said in an interview with The Associated Press.  “I just wish I had a wand and could make it go faster, but I can&#8217;t.  We do everything we can. &#8220;</p>
<p>Trotter said he has a plan to eventually sell the stock without paying taxes on potential gains but would not disclose his price target.  Stocks, which last hovered around $ 10, must rise to about $ 14 per share for the trust to hit $ 13.5 billion.</p>
<p>Wall Street analysts predict that PG &#038; E&#8217;s stock could hit $ 13-17 in the next 12 months, which would mark a dramatic turnaround.  The stock is down 17% so far this year, while the S&#038;P 500 is up 14%.</p>
<p>The trust has made some progress.  By June 30, it had paid out $ 436.4 million.  That&#8217;s still only 3.2% of the $ 13.5 billion earmarked for fire victims, a sign of &#8220;designed dysfunction&#8221; built into the utility&#8217;s bankruptcy regimes, said Will Abrams, a victim of a PG&#038;E caused wildfire that terrorized his hometown of Santa Rosa in 2017.</p>
<p>&#8220;I was really disappointed,&#8221; said Abrams.  “The bankruptcy was being sold as something that would hold PG&#038;E accountable, and it wasn&#8217;t.  Bankruptcy is not a reorganization process.  It is a process of dividing the dollars. &#8220;</p>
<p>But nearly 45,000 victims voted for the plan, with only 6,109 opposed to it according to court documents, paving the way for US bankruptcy judge Dennis Montali approval.</p>
<p>Many victims were influenced by attorneys who participated in settlement negotiations, arguing that the plan was the best option.  Eight of those attorneys are now part of a nine-member supervisory committee on the victim&#8217;s trust, an arrangement that Abrams believes was a conflict of interest.</p>
<p>Amy Bach, the only member of the Fiduciary Committee who was not involved in PG &#038; E&#8217;s bankruptcy negotiations, insists that everyone tries to ensure that all forest fire victims receive money as soon as possible.  The attorneys involved are motivated to achieve this because their fees are dependent on their clients being paid.</p>
<p>&#8220;We put as much pressure on the claims team as possible,&#8221; said Bach, executive director of United Policeholders, a nonprofit group she founded nearly 30 years ago to fight insurers on behalf of fire victims.  &#8220;You seem to be hearing us, it feels like things are speeding up.&#8221;</p>
<p>Frank Pitre, another member of the oversight committee and one of the attorneys representing burn victims, admitted that things have turned out more slowly than he had hoped.  That is one of the reasons why he rates Trotter and his team with a “B” for their commitment to date.</p>
<p>&#8220;There is a lot of room for improvement,&#8221; said Pitre, but added that &#8220;I have no doubt that the effort is there.&#8221;</p>
<p>PG&#038;E believes it has already done its part in helping fire victims.</p>
<p>&#8220;We financed the trust according to our reorganization plan,&#8221; the utility company said in a statement to the AP.  &#8220;PG&#038;E is not involved in the distribution of trust funds.&#8221;</p>
<p>PG &#038; E&#8217;s Chief Risk Officer, Sumeet Singh, enumerated a wide range of improvements, including using more advanced technology to prevent forest fires from starting and detect them more quickly.</p>
<p>Although PG&#038;E did not live up to expectations, Singh said, “I am very encouraged by the new leadership, (a) new playbook, rigor and discipline that we are on the right track.  We know we can do better and we will do better. &#8220;</p>
<p>Trotter, meanwhile, holds his breath as the weather warms and the Northern California landscape dries up.</p>
<p>&#8220;We are dealing with the hand that was dealt to us,&#8221; said Trotter.  “(PG&#038;E) says the right things.  Now we just have to see if they are doing the right things. &#8220;</p>

<p>SAN FRANCISCO (AP) &#8211; A San Francisco man was charged with an unprovoked attack on a BART station that killed one person and seriously injured another.</p>
<p>20-year-old Keshon Wilson first appeared in court on Tuesday and should be charged with murder, attempted murder and assault in two weeks, which could result in a potential life sentence if convicted, the San Francisco Examiner reported.</p>
<p>A lawyer who represented him did not immediately respond to a request for comment, the newspaper said.</p>
<p>Wilson, who worked for a private company, was washing the mission station with electricity on the night of March 29 when he walked up to a group of people and opened fire, authorities claim.</p>
<p>Isaiah Cardenas, 26, was shot three times in the back and died on the scene.  A second man was beaten five times in the stomach and shoulder but was able to log off the police and was taken to a hospital, the investigator said.</p>
<p>Wilson drove off in his work truck and was arrested at his home last Friday after returning from a trip to Las Vegas, prosecutors said.</p>
<p>The authorities did not mention any possible motive for the attack.</p>
